Understanding the pervasiveness of the criminal justice system’s reach into low-income communities is critical to meeting the civil legal needs of these communities. Advocates can learn more about this phenomenon by using a model that maps how criminal justice policies operate locally, beginning with the deployment of law enforcement resources. With the system deconstructed, advocates can consider ways to intervene to minimize harm to clients.
